Our challenge this time over at Crafty Cardmakers is hosted by BettyC and she would like you to use more than 1 punch or die cut. You can have a combination such as 1 punch and 1 diecut as that equals two, or two punches, two diecuts. You can use more if you wish as long as there is at least two in combination or two of either on your creation.

Here is my creation:



I have painted a wooden photo frame blank with acrylic paint and die cut flowers and leaves using Marianne dies. I have added pearls to the centre of the roses.
